New Premium Seating Coming to Ohio Stadium in 2026

  • For the 2026 campaign, Ohio State plans to introduce a new field-level section featuring 400 premium chairback seats at its stadium.
  • The addition follows plans to modernize the stadium while honoring its traditions, with the Ohio State Marching Band moving to the north end zone.
  • The new seats sit atop nine field-level suites in the south end zone and include amenities such as dedicated restrooms and access through the player tunnel.
  • Each season ticket, priced at $6,000, grants access to the 1922 Club, where fans can enjoy unlimited food and beverages, private restrooms, and special members-only events.
  • This premium seating expansion aims to enhance the fan experience and provide more comfort and seating options, reflecting Ohio State's commitment to stadium modernization.
